NEW DELHI: India’s premier research organization Centre for Cellular and Molecular Biology (CCMB) is preparing diagnostic kits to test COVID-19, which has so far infected 562 people and claimed 11 lives across the country. “We are providing support to our incubating companies and testing and validating the diagnostic kits proposed by them.

We may come up with some good kits," said RK Mishra, director, CCMB, Hyderabad. He added that the process may take at least two weeks, since quality and accuracy would be a key concern.

India has so far tested over 23,000 samples and government continues to expand the network of government and private laboratories conducting the tests.
